在当今这个快速发展的互联网时代,大前端开发已经成为了一个热门的领域。而在这个领域里,原型设计是至关重要的一个环节。一个优秀的前端原型不仅能够帮助开发者更好地理解产品需求,还能在项目开发过程中起到指导和沟通的作用。本文将从零开始,详细介绍大前端项目原型的设计技巧,并通过实战案例,帮助读者轻松掌握原型设计的方法。
一、大前端项目原型的意义
大前端项目原型是指在项目开发前,通过图形化工具或代码实现的产品界面和交互效果。它具有以下意义:
- 明确需求:原型可以帮助团队成员对产品需求有一个清晰的认识,避免在开发过程中出现偏差。
- 降低沟通成本:通过原型,团队成员可以直观地了解产品的功能和界面,减少口头沟通和文档撰写的成本。
- 提高开发效率:原型可以作为开发团队的参考,确保开发方向正确,提高开发效率。
- 评估可行性:原型可以帮助团队评估项目的可行性,为项目决策提供依据。
二、大前端项目原型设计技巧
- 明确目标用户:在设计原型之前,首先要明确目标用户,了解他们的需求和习惯,以便设计出符合用户需求的原型。
- 梳理需求:将需求分解为具体的页面和功能,明确每个页面的内容和交互方式。
- 选择合适的工具:目前市面上有很多原型设计工具,如Axure、Sketch、Figma等。选择合适的工具可以帮助你更高效地完成原型设计。
- 注重用户体验:在设计原型时,要关注用户体验,确保页面布局合理、交互流畅。
- 细节处理:在原型设计中,细节处理非常重要。例如,按钮的点击效果、表单验证等,都需要在原型中体现出来。
三、实战案例
以下是一个简单的实战案例,帮助你更好地理解大前端项目原型的设计过程。
案例背景
某公司开发一款在线教育平台,需要设计一个课程列表页面。
设计步骤
- 明确目标用户:该平台的目标用户主要是学生和教师。
- 梳理需求:课程列表页面需要展示课程名称、课程简介、课程时长、课程价格等信息,并提供搜索、筛选、排序等功能。
- 选择工具:使用Axure RP进行原型设计。
- 设计页面:
- 头部:包含平台logo、搜索框、用户头像等元素。
- 主体:展示课程列表,包括课程名称、课程简介、课程时长、课程价格等信息。
- 底部:包含筛选、排序、分页等操作。
- 细节处理:
- 搜索框:实现关键词搜索功能。
- 筛选:根据课程类型、价格、时长等进行筛选。
- 排序:根据课程热度、评分等进行排序。
设计效果
通过以上步骤,我们可以得到一个功能完善、界面美观的课程列表原型。以下为部分设计效果截图:
四、总结
大前端项目原型设计是一个复杂而细致的过程,需要设计师具备良好的需求理解能力、用户体验意识和设计技巧。通过本文的介绍,相信你已经对大前端项目原型设计有了初步的认识。在实际操作中,不断积累经验,多尝试不同的设计方法,相信你一定能成为一名优秀的前端原型设计师。
